Residential clearance prices in Walkden

Fixed bands, quoted before we start. What moves the price is access, stair turns, parking distance and the size of the job — not the postcode you live in.

Residential clearance price guide for Walkden
PackageWhat it coversPrice
Single roomA bedroom, box room or study emptied, swept and photographed.from £130
Loft, garage or cellarBagged contents, boxes and stored furniture brought down and out.from £180
Part house (multiple rooms)Two or three rooms plus storage, staged in one visit.from £310
Whole propertyEvery room, loft to cellar, plus garden furniture and the shed.from £520

Fixed from photos or a free survey and inclusive of labour, dismantling, carry-out from any floor, transport, tipping and the digital waste transfer note. No hourly meter and no permit fees.

Can you clear a flat with no lift in Walkden?

Yes. Tell us the floor and whether the block needs a booked service lift or loading bay, and we size the crew so it still finishes in one visit. Stairs are not charged extra.

What can't you take away from Walkden?

Asbestos, clinical or chemical waste, gas bottles, fuel and liquid paint. Flag those when you enquire and we will point you to a licensed specialist or price a separate documented collection.
